2011-07-26 3 views
1

VSTO 2007에서 추가 기능이 있습니다.이 기능을 위해 Click-once deployment 유틸리티를 만들었습니다. .vsto 파일 또는 set-up.exe를 두 번 클릭하여 추가 기능을 설치 한이 다양한 클라이언트를 배포했습니다. 하나만 제외한 모든 클라이언트에서 정상적으로 작동합니다. 분명히 그것은 특정 클라이언트 시스템과 관련이 있지만 로그인 할 수있는 권한이 없기 때문에 내 손이 묶여 있는지 확인합니다.한 번 클릭 배포 유틸리티 Throwing System.NullReferenceException

예외는 다음과 같습니다. 비슷한 상황에 처한 사람이 있습니까? 메시지에는 많은 정보가 없기 때문에 나는 조금 붙어있다. VSTO의 ClickOnce를 나의 경험을 설치

Name: 
From : file////C:/ExcelAddin/Adding.vsto 
System.NullReferenceException : Object reference not set to 
instance of an Object at 
Microsoft.VisualStudio.Tools.Applications.Deployment.ClickOnceAddInDeploymentManager 
.GetManifests(TomeSpan timeout) 
at 
Microsoft.VisualStudio.Tools.Applications.Deployment.ClickOnceAddInDeploymentManager 
.InstallAddIn() 

광범위한 아니지만 나는이 기계 또는 보안 설정으로 VSTO/설치 문제가 있지만 문제가되지 않는 것을 알고있다. FYI 모든 클라이언트는 로컬 관리자입니다.

답변

1

닷넷 프레임 워크 3.5 SP1을 재설치하여 해결되었습니다.

관련 문제